This is an automated email announcing the release of genpatches-2.6.18-4
CHANGES SINCE 2.6.18-3
-----------------------
Revision 704:
Fix e1000 suspend/resume regression (dsd)
Added: 2410_e1000-suspend.patch
Revision 705:
Fix xt_physdev compile error (dsd)
Added: 2005_netfilter-physdev-dep.patch
Revision 706:
Fix microcode update fail with microcode-ctl-1.15 (dsd)
Added: 1700_x86-microcode-size.patch
Revision 707:
Fix ieee1394 module reload oops on PPC (dsd)
Added: 2300_ieee1394-ppc-reload.patch
Revision 709:
2410_e1000-suspend.patch is included with 2.6.18.3. (phreak)
Deleted: 2410_e1000-suspend.patch
Revision 710:
Linux 2.6.18.3. (phreak)
Added: 1002_linux-2.6.18.3.patch
Revision 711:
Resorting the README. (phreak)
Revision 714:
2.6.18-4 release (dsd)

ABOUT GENPATCHES
----------------
genpatches is the patchset applied to some kernels available in Portage.
For more information, see the genpatches homepage:
http://dev.gentoo.org/~dsd/genpatches
For a simple example of how to use genpatches in your kernel ebuild, look at a
recent gentoo-sources-2.6.* ebuild.
